of E. rhusiopathiae isolated from pigs affected by erysipelas and concluded
that the field isolates belonging to a specific RAPD type, namely RAPD
1–2, were Koganei strains. The RAPD genotyping method appeared to
be useful for discriminating the vaccine from field isolates. However,
some strains of serovar 1b also belong to the RAPD 1–2 type (Nagai
et al., 2008).
